    This belongs to my Dad. Found it recently in a pile of old stuff. It used to entertain me for ages when I was a kid :) One of my best memories of childhood. It looks a little worn out, but still works great after a change of batteries (LR1130). The melody is "When The Saints Go Marching In", if I'm not mistaken.

    On the game, the 'n's appear when a calculation to ten has been made, your example doesn't show this. Just look for pairs of 2+8, 1+9, 3+7, etc or other patterns of 2+3+5. I used to get screenfuls of 'nnnn's and the closer they are to the lives bar, the higher you score.
